Ferric alum gives deep red colour with NH4SCN due to the formation of :
Options
A.Al(SCN)3
B.[Fe(SCN)3]-
C.Fe(SCN)3
D.None of these.
Solution
Ferric alum contains Fe3+ ions ; Fe3+ + 3SCN- → Fe(SCN)3 (deep red colouration).
